Jennifer Rubio was born in the Philippines in 1986 or 1987. She moved to New Jersey when she was seven years old, having grown up in various cities across three continents. Her early entrepreneurial spirit was evident when, as a child, she acquired a lemonade stand by borrowing $20 from her father. Rubio attended Pennsylvania State University, initially pursuing a supply-chain management major. During her time at Penn State, she participated in a co-op program at Johnson & Johnson. Discovering a strong desire to pursue a career in business, Rubio left Penn State just before graduating to accept a full-time position at Neutrogena, where she had previously completed another co-op experience.
Rubio’s career progressed through marketing and social media roles before she joined Warby Parker in 2011 as the head of social media, leading early content and partnership initiatives. This role proved pivotal, as it was there she met Stephanie Korey, her future co-founder. In 2013, Rubio relocated to London, taking on the role of global director of innovation for the fashion brand AllSaints. Her tenure at AllSaints involved extensive international travel, further shaping her perspective on the travel industry. She also shared her expertise as an adjunct professor of social media at Miami Ad School and has been a guest lecturer at institutions such as Hyper Island, New York University,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ania, Northwestern University, and Harvard University.
In 2015, Jen Rubio co-founded Away with Stephanie Korey, establishing a direct-to-consumer travel and luggage company. Away quickly distinguished itself with its focus on design and brand storytelling, particularly leveraging platforms like Instagram. By 2017, Away had successfully raised $31 million, marking it as one of the largest seed-financed female-backed startups at the time. Rubio served as the CEO of Away from 2021 until 2025, when she transitioned to the role of executive chair. Her leadership has been central to Away’s growth and its impact on the travel goods market. She married Slack CEO Stewart Butterfield in 2020, and they have two children.
